I takeaway 100% – Moisture% say moisture on tin is 78% then I takeaway 100-78= 22 thats the dry matter =22% then look on can what’s the fat, say 5% I then get the calculater & devide, I put 5 that’s the fat on tin then devide by 22 then I press the % on the calculater & u’ll get 22.727272 so the fat is about 22%..even if u just put 5 devided by 22 I still get the 0.22.727272 there’s just a 0 in front does that make sense..
